Debunking Common Athlete Diet Myths

The diets of elite athletes are frequently shrouded in mystery and misconception. One prominent myth suggests that these top performers subsist solely on ‘junk food,’ an idea sometimes reinforced by viral stories. For instance, the legendary sprinter Usain Bolt was known to have consumed a significant number of chicken nuggets at the Beijing Olympics, a choice that might seem counterintuitive for someone aiming for gold medals. Similarly, NFL stars like Marshawn Lynch and Tyreek Hill have been associated with pre-game snacks like Skittles and “Cheetah fuel” (a grandmother’s secret recipe involving oatmeal cream pies), respectively. While these stories are memorable, it is crucial to understand the context. What appears to be an ‘unhealthy’ choice is often strategically consumed for immediate energy during intense periods of competition, where quick digestion and glucose availability are paramount. This is a far cry from a daily dietary staple.

Conversely, another prevalent myth posits that elite athletes maintain an unblemished, 100% clean diet at all times. While many athletes do prioritize highly nutritious foods, the video highlights that strict adherence every single day is not always the case, nor is it always necessary. Dr. Marc Bubbs, a renowned coach to Olympians, clarifies that dietary recall is often unreliable. What is captured as a one-off meal or a momentary indulgence might be misrepresented as an athlete’s consistent diet. For example, Tom Brady, known for his rigorous nutritional approach, has even acknowledged the importance of incorporating occasional ‘treats’ like pizza and bacon, emphasizing that the stress of rigid perfection can be more detrimental than an occasional indulgence. The key distinction lies between strategic consumption for performance and the overarching dietary pattern that supports long-term health and readiness.

Understanding Strategic Eating vs. Everyday Nutrition

The difference between an athlete’s strategic pre-game fueling and their daily nutritional intake is a critical point that is often missed. The video illustrates this with examples of athletes who appear to have contradictory dietary statements. DK Metcalf, for instance, was noted for claiming to run on candy, yet also spoke of a low-carb, vegetable-focused diet to another publication. These seemingly conflicting accounts underscore that athletes adapt their food choices based on specific needs: pre-competition, during recovery, or simply maintaining overall health during an off-season. For immediate energy during competitions, readily digestible simple sugars are often preferred due to their rapid absorption into the bloodstream, as suggested by Dr. Bubbs. This is a performance-driven choice, rather than a health-driven one.

In contrast, everyday nutrition for elite athletes, as echoed by Dr. Bubbs, usually involves a more balanced and foundational approach. LeBron James, while rumored to enjoy cookies, also emphasizes a pre-competition meal of chicken breast and pasta, focusing on carbohydrates for sustained energy. Other top athletes like Mo Salah, Cristiano Ronaldo, and Simone Biles tend to favor meals centered around lean protein, complex carbohydrates, and a rich array of vegetables, such as sweet potato, chicken, broccoli, and rice. These foods provide sustained energy, support muscle repair, and deliver essential micronutrients. This consistent, fundamental approach forms the backbone of their diet, allowing for the occasional strategic ‘unhealthy’ fuel without compromising overall performance or health.

The Truth About Athlete Supplementation

Supplementation is an area rife with misinformation, particularly when it pertains to elite athletes. The allure of a ‘magic pill’ that can unlock superior performance is powerful, leading many to mimic the supplement stacks of their athletic idols. The video, however, strongly cautions against blindly copying an athlete’s supplement choices. A prime example is the dangerous misconception about Viagra being a performance enhancer, humorously (but alarmingly) mentioned by Chad Johnson. Dr. Bubbs vehemently clarifies that there is zero evidence to support such claims and that it is far more likely to backfire, causing serious health issues.

Instead of chasing unproven fads, it is smarter to choose supplements based on robust scientific evidence and expert advice. The most evidence-based supplements for athletes typically revolve around addressing common deficiencies and supporting recovery and adaptation. Dr. Marc Bubbs highlights several key supplements:

  • Vitamin D: This vitamin is crucial for immune function and satellite cell activity, which is vital for muscle repair and growth. Achieving levels above 90 nanomoles per liter is associated with immune benefits, while levels above 75 nanomoles per liter support satellite cell activity. Those living in winter climates are particularly susceptible to deficiency and can significantly benefit from supplementation.
  • Omega-3: Essential fatty acids like Omega-3 are important for reducing inflammation, supporting brain health, and contributing to longevity. An Omega-3 index range ideally above 8% is targeted for performance and overall health benefits.
  • Magnesium: Athletes, due to increased physiological demands, require 10 to 20% more magnesium than the general population. This mineral plays a role in hundreds of bodily processes, including muscle function, nerve transmission, energy production, and bone health.
  • Creatine: Widely recognized for its ability to enhance strength, power, and muscle recovery, creatine is a cornerstone supplement for many athletes.
  • Caffeine: A well-known stimulant, caffeine can boost energy, improve focus, and reduce the perception of effort during exercise.

While these supplements offer tangible benefits, it is emphasized by Dr. Bubbs and even Tom Brady that they cannot replace proper nutrition. The “food-first approach” championed by experts stresses that whole foods provide a synergistic array of micronutrients and compounds that are not fully replicable in isolated supplement form. A balanced diet remains the foundation, with supplements serving as targeted support.

Prioritizing Micronutrients: Beyond Macronutrients

While macronutrients (protein, carbs, fats) often dominate discussions about athlete diets, the significance of micronutrients—vitamins and minerals—cannot be overstated. Elite athletes, despite their rigorous training and careful planning, can still face deficiencies that impair performance and health. A concerning study on 19 Brazilian footballers, for example, revealed significant micronutrient shortfalls: 68% consumed insufficient magnesium and calcium, 74% lacked vitamin A, and a staggering 100% failed to get enough vitamin D. Such deficiencies can detrimentally impact testosterone levels, immunity, and the health of joints and muscles, which are critical for sustained athletic careers. This understanding led Lionel Messi, for instance, to hire a nutritionist in 2014, signaling a shift towards more meticulous dietary planning.

The video also touches upon dietary exclusions, such as gluten and dairy, popular among some athletes like Novak Djokovic. While some individuals may have genuine intolerances (e.g., lactose intolerance causing gas and bloating), Dr. Bubbs notes that for those who can digest dairy, it is actually considered a “gold standard protein.” The issue with gluten-containing foods like bread is often tied to their fermentability, which can cause discomfort in individuals with compromised gut health, particularly when combined with stress and poor sleep. The broader takeaway is that these exclusions are highly individualized; they are not universally beneficial for all athletes. What is universally beneficial, however, is a diet rich in whole, unprocessed foods that naturally provide a spectrum of micronutrients. Top sports clubs often provide smoothie bars and abundant fruits in their canteens to ensure their players receive these vital components, underpinning the ‘food-first’ philosophy.

Macronutrients: The Foundation of Elite Athlete Diets

Once the importance of micronutrients is established, the focus naturally shifts to macronutrients – protein, carbohydrates, and fats – which form the bulk of an athlete’s energy intake and structural building blocks. It is the overall balance and quantity of these that truly underpin elite performance, rather than minute details of nutrient timing.

The Crucial Role of Protein

Protein is universally acknowledged as a cornerstone of an athlete’s diet, vital for muscle growth, repair, and recovery. Dr. Bubbs suggests that protein intake is one of the more consistent aspects of an athlete’s diet that can be “set and forget.” For American footballers, a study indicates a daily protein intake ranging from 160 to 230 grams, depending on position and body weight. Surprisingly, Premier League players, despite often being smaller in stature, averaged around 205 grams of protein per day, exceeding UEFA’s recommendations. This substantial intake highlights protein’s essential role in rebuilding tissues stressed by intense training and competition, ensuring athletes are ready for their next challenge.

Carbohydrates: Fueling High-Performance

The amount of carbohydrates consumed by elite athletes can be astonishing and is often what surprises many. Carbohydrates are the body’s primary and most efficient fuel source for high-intensity activity. While Premier League players might have a significant intake, a Tour de France cyclist on mountainous stages might consume an astounding 15 grams per kilogram of body weight per day. For a 65kg rider, this translates to nearly 1,000 grams of carbohydrates daily! This extreme intake is necessary to meet the immense energy demands of endurance sports, preventing fatigue and maintaining performance over prolonged periods. Athletes often rely on fast carbohydrates, or simple sugars, during competition to provide rapid energy when the body is under maximal stress, demonstrating a performance-driven approach to fueling.

Fats: More Than Just Energy

Despite fats often being demonized in popular media, they are an integral and critical component of an athlete’s diet. Athletes typically derive 20 to 35% of their total calories from fats. Dietary fats are essential for hormone production, vitamin absorption (especially fat-soluble vitamins A, D, E, and K), and provide a concentrated source of energy, particularly for longer duration, lower-intensity activities. Healthy fats, such as those found in avocados, nuts, seeds, and fatty fish, also contribute to overall health and help manage inflammation, which is vital for recovery and injury prevention in demanding athletic careers. These macronutrients, in concert, provide the necessary energy and building blocks for athletes to perform at their absolute best.

Caloric Needs of Elite Athletes: An Understated Imperative

Perhaps the most understated yet fundamentally critical aspect of elite athlete nutrition is their total caloric intake. To say that athletes consume a lot of calories is a profound understatement; their energy demands dwarf those of the average person. For instance, basketball players can require between 3,000 and 4,000 calories daily, while American footballers often consume upwards of 5,000 calories per day, with specific amounts varying by position and body weight. Premier League footballers, according to a small study, burned an average of 3,789 calories on match days and 2,956 calories on training days.

For endurance athletes, these figures skyrocket even further, often reaching 6,000 to 6,500 calories per day, necessitating a high intake of easily digestible carbohydrates, often in the form of simple sugars, to rapidly replenish glycogen stores. Insufficient caloric intake can lead to poor recovery, weight loss, and compromised performance, whereas excessive calories can result in fat gain. However, the video provocatively highlights that a slightly higher body fat percentage is not always detrimental to performance, using the example of NHL player Phil Kessel, who despite having one of the higher body fats on his team, consistently tested first in performance categories and missed the fewest games. This demonstrates that performance optimization is not always directly correlated with the lowest body fat percentage, challenging common aesthetic ideals.

The fundamental principle here, as Dr. Bubbs explains, is the concept of energy balance—ensuring enough fuel is available to meet the demands of intense training and competition. This massive caloric requirement is often overlooked when people try to emulate the specific food choices of athletes. Without addressing the underlying energy needs, any attempt to copy a diet will inevitably fall short. It’s akin to having a high-performance sports car but failing to fill its tank; the individual components are impressive, but without sufficient fuel, the machine cannot perform.

Consistency and Fundamentals in Athlete Nutrition

Ultimately, the success of elite athletes in their dietary strategies hinges not on obscure supplements or extreme restrictions, but on the mastery of fundamental principles and unwavering consistency. The video powerfully conveys that while social media and advertising often sensationalize the “shiny new toy”—be it a unique herb or a novel diet trend—true elite performance is built upon consistently nailing the basics. Dr. Marc Bubbs uses the analogy of a car: energy intake is the gas in the tank, without which the car cannot even run. Micronutrition is like maintaining the engine, ensuring it runs smoothly and the athlete remains resilient and adaptable to training stress.

This commitment to fundamental nutrition—adequate energy, balanced macronutrients, and sufficient micronutrients—is what sets top athletes apart. They understand that making small, consistent improvements in these “big buckets” yields far greater results than chasing marginal gains from “pint glass” strategies. As Dr. Bubbs notes, some athletes might possess genetic advantages that allow them to deviate from perfect diets in their youth, but with increasing competition, meticulous nutrition becomes a key differentiator. The ability to show up day after day, week after week, and compete at the highest level is the best predictor of success, and this consistency is directly supported by a well-managed nutritional foundation. Therefore, when observing the diets of elite athletes, it is their consistent adherence to these core principles, rather than any singular “secret” food or supplement, that truly empowers their extraordinary achievements.
